Synopsis

Mhon, a young woman raised by her aunt Chanramphai—a fortune teller—has grown up believing deeply in destiny and soulmates. Having lost her parents at a young age, loneliness shaped her into someone who loves traveling and dreams of becoming a tour guide one day. However, a childhood stutter left her lacking the confidence to pursue guide training and certification. For now, she works at a Watsons store and has a peculiar habit of sending postcards to herself.
These postcards are delivered daily by Phumjai, a rookie postman. Though he is intrigued by the postcards, the two have never actually met. Worse, Phumjai mistakenly assumes they are from Mhon’s lover.
One day, Mhon meets Nepali, a traveler from Nepal who roams the world to avoid returning home due to unresolved issues with his mother, Orawee. Their first encounter sparks instant feelings in Mhon, who believes Nepali is her destined soulmate, just as foretold by her tarot cards. Inspired by him, she finally gains the courage to pass her tour guide exam.
Meanwhile, Nepali is forced to return to Nepal. As Mhon rushes to share her good news, she loses control of her car and crashes into Phumjai, leaving both unconscious. Nepali, who waits for her until the last moment, is ultimately forced to leave.
When Mhon regains consciousness, she discovers the devastating consequences of her actions—Phumjai has suffered severe brain trauma and fallen into a coma. Covered in bandages in the ICU, his face remains unknown to her. She learns he has no family and has spent years searching for his mother, who disappeared two decades ago.
Determined to take responsibility, Mhon works hard to cover his medical expenses and eventually becomes a trainee tour guide. During this time, Phumjai is cared for by Baiเตย, a nurse who feels a strange bond with him.
By coincidence, Mhon later joins a Nepal tour organized by her company and reunites with Nepali. His family runs a resort and spa in a valley town, and their relationship quickly deepens. However, their happiness is threatened by Khun Nu Lek, Nepali’s business partner, who harbors feelings for him and resents Mhon’s presence.
Back in Thailand, Phumjai awakens from his coma and discovers countless postcards from a mysterious woman—Mhon. Reading them one by one, he learns about her life and her efforts to earn money to save him. Though they’ve never met, he begins to feel deeply connected to her. However, before he can reply, he receives a postcard revealing Mhon’s growing love for Nepali. Afraid of losing this connection, he decides to hide the truth.
In Nepal, Khun Nu Lek plots against Mhon, abandoning her in a market and orchestrating a theft. A rude yet helpful Thai stranger rescues her—unbeknownst to her, it is Phumjai himself. After losing his belongings, he forces Mhon to take responsibility by letting him stay at Nepali’s resort in exchange for work. Ironically, she has no idea he is the “sleeping prince” she’s been caring for.
With help from a local guide named Khola, Phumjai creates situations to make Mhon believe he is her destined partner. Yet every encounter leads to arguments, and Mhon comes to see him as a source of bad luck.
As time passes, subtle feelings begin to grow between them. Though Nepali is kind and dependable, he doesn’t understand her as deeply as Phumjai seems to. Mhon even wishes Nepali could read her heart the way Phumjai does.
Eventually, Mhon travels to the Himalayas to pray for the “sleeping prince” to awaken. Nepali accompanies her, with Phumjai tagging along as a porter. During the journey, Nepali realizes Phumjai’s love for Mhon. After returning, Nepali proposes marriage. Misunderstanding the situation, Phumjai believes she has accepted and quietly leaves Nepal, heartbroken.
Back in Bangkok, he lives alone until he receives another postcard from Mhon, revealing her confusing feelings toward the “man of bad luck.” Hope returns—but is cut short when he suffers severe headaches. Doctors discover complications in his brain, requiring risky surgery that may erase his memories.
With little time left, Phumjai returns to Nepal to confess everything—his identity as the sleeping prince and his true feelings. But he arrives just as Nepali proposes to Mhon again.
Who will Mhon choose—Phumjai or Nepali?
